Advancements in electric cars will benefit the North East, says MEP
AS the North East gears up towards playing an important role in the production of electric vehicles, one of the region’s MEPs is taking things one step further by pushing for a European electro-mobility strategy.
Nissan’s Leaf will be built on Wearside in 2013 and North East MEP Fiona Hall believes the North East must propel the advancement of electro-mobility in Europe further, if the North East is to be benefit in the long term.
She said: “Pushing the advance of electro-mobility in Europe will greatly benefit the North East.
“It is important for the region to make use of and push efforts at the European level to promote and develop the electro-mobility sector.
“Rolling out electric vehicles across Europe will help regional economic growth and job creation in the North East.”
